Expert's choice: Portuguese wine
Quinta da Falorca, Lagar Reserva, Dão 2004
Expressive, almost eucalyptus top note to cassis and mint, with a charry background. The palate has impressive ripeness, the cappuccino silkiness of the oak adding creaminess to blackcurrant pastille fruit. 18pts/20
Price: £19.99–£29.95 Armit, Harrods, WoodWinters
Drink: 2011–2018
Alc: 14.5%
